This 5-day Kenyan safari adventure departs from Nairobi to connect three distinct ecosystems, beginning with a drive north into the misty, high-altitude montane rainforests of Aberdare National Park to view wildlife from an iconic floodlit tree lodge. Next, you will descend into the Great Rift Valley to Lake Nakuru National Park to track endangered black and white rhinos, Rothschild’s giraffes, and pink flamingos along the water’s edge. The journey concludes with two immersive days in the rolling golden grasslands of the world-famous Masai Mara National Reserve, where you will track the Big Five and scout the historic Mara River before returning to the capital via a panoramic rift valley escarpment viewpoint.

🏰 4. Check-In at the Historic Forest "Tree Lodge" Arrive at your unique forest accommodation, such as The Ark. Modeled after Noah's Ark, this historic wooden structure is built on elevated pillars directly over a massive, natural salt lick and a permanent forest watering hole. Walk the wooden decks to your cabin-style room and step out onto the viewing verandas....
🦏 5. Afternoon Waterhole Viewing & The Ground Bunker Spend your afternoon relaxing on the lodge's multiple viewing decks. Because the soil here is rich in natural minerals, wildlife is drawn directly to the lodge. Watch massive herds of elephants, cape buffalos, and waterbucks graze just meters below you. For a thrilling angle, take the stairs down to the ground-level viewing bunker, where you can stand safely behind a slit window just inches away from drinking animals....
🌌 6. Dinner & The Night-Watch Buzzer System As night falls, powerful floodlights illuminate the watering hole, revealing shy, nocturnal forest species like leopards, hyenas, spotted genets, and rare giant forest hogs. Enjoy a multi-course dinner in the glass-walled dining room.

🌊 3. Stop at Nyahururu (Thomson’s Falls) Along the route, your driver will make a scenic stop at the town of Nyahururu to visit Thomson’s Falls, a spectacular 74-meter-tall waterfall on the Ewaso Narok River. Take a 20-minute break to stretch your legs, stand at the misty cliffside viewpoint for photos, and use the restrooms before driving down onto the flat valley floor....

🦩 6. Panoramic Sunset at Baboon Cliff Before the park gates close, your guide will drive up the steep, winding track to Baboon Cliff, an elevated viewpoint perched high above the lake. From this vantage point, you will get a magnificent panoramic look at the entire lakebed, often lined with a pink fringe of thousands of feeding flamingos and pelicans, set against a classic African sunset. 🌳 3. The Hippo Pools & A Picnic Bush Lunch Drive down to the historic Mara River. Accompanied by an armed park ranger, you will take a short walk along the riverbanks to see massive pods of hundreds of hippos fighting for space, alongside giant Nile crocodiles basking in the sun. Afterward, your guide will find a safe, solitary acacia tree out on the open plains to set up a memorable picnic bush lunch directly on the savannah....
🐆 4. Afternoon Cheetah Sprint Scouting After lunch, explore the wide, flat grasslands favored by cheetahs. Because they rely on pure speed to hunt, they prefer open terrain. Look closely at the tops of termite mounds and fallen logs—cheetahs use these elevated vantage points to scan for Thompson's gazelles and impalas....

🪵 2. Masai Village Cultural Visit Before hitting the highway, stop at an authentic, local Masai Manyatta (Village). Meet the village elders, watch the traditional Adumu (the famous jumping dance) performed by the Masai warriors, and tour their traditional mud-walled homesteads. You will learn about their ancient nomadic customs, livestock herding, and beadwork....
